Sushi Rolls: A Delicious and Healthy Stay at Home Parent Recipe
As a stay at home parent, finding the time and energy to make delicious, healthy meals for your family can be a challenge. One of my go-to recipes is homemade sushi rolls. Not only are they delicious and healthy, but they’re also fun to make! Here’s what you’ll need:
Ingredients:
– 2 cups of cooked sushi rice (plus 1 teaspoon of rice vinegar)
– 4 sheets of nori seaweed
– 1 avocado
– 1 cucumber
– 4 ounces of smoked salmon
– 2 tablespoons of mayonnaise
– 2 tablespoons of sesame seeds
– Soy sauce for dipping (optional)Instructions:
1. Start by preparing the sushi rice according to the package directions. When it is finished cooking, stir in 1 teaspoon of rice vinegar and set aside.
2. Cut the avocado, cucumber, and smoked salmon into thin strips.
3. Place one sheet of nori seaweed on a bamboo rolling mat. Spread ¼ cup of cooked sushi rice onto the nori sheet with a spoon or rubber spatula.
4. Place the avocado, cucumber, and smoked salmon strips in a line down the center of the sushi roll.
5. Spread a thin layer of mayonnaise over the top of the ingredients in the center of the roll.
6. Sprinkle sesame seeds over the top.
7. Roll the sushi up by starting at one end and rolling it tightly with your fingers or with the help of the bamboo mat until it forms a cylinder shape. Be sure to keep it tight so that all of your ingredients stay inside!
8. Slice each roll into 8 pieces with a sharp knife dipped in cold water.You can enjoy your homemade sushi rolls as is or dip them in soy sauce for extra flavor! The best part about making sushi rolls at home is that you can customize them however you like – add more vegetables or switch out ingredients for whatever you have on hand!
